[DETAIL SETTINGS] 5. Using On-Screen Menu [GENERAL] Storing Your Customized Settings [REFERENCE] This function allows you to store your customized settings in [PRESET 1] to [PRESET 7]. First, select a base preset mode from [REFERENCE], then set [GAMMA CORRECTION] and [COLOR TEMPERATURE]. HIGH-BRIGHT Recommended for use in a brightly lit room. PRESENTATION Recommended for making a presentation using a PowerPoint file. VIDEO Recommended for typical TV program viewing. MOVIE Recommended for movies. GRAPHIC Recommended for graphics. sRGB Standard color values. DICOM SIM Recommended for DICOM simulation format. Selecting Gamma Correction Mode [GAMMA CORRECTION] Each mode is recommended for: DYNAMIC Creates a high-contrast picture. NATURAL Natural reproduction of the picture. BLACK DETAIL Emphasizes detail in dark areas of the picture. NOTE: This function is not available when [DICOM SIM.] is selected for [DETAIL SETTINGS]. Selecting Screen Size for DICOM SIM [SCREEN SIZE] This function will perform gamma correction appropriate for the screen size. LARGE For screen size of 150" MEDIUM For screen size of 100" SMALL For screen size of 50" NOTE: This function is available only when [DICOM SIM.] is selected for [DETAIL SETTINGS]. 75
